Test Management
Test Management focuses on planning, estimating, monitoring, controlling, and improving software testing projects. This category explains concepts such as risk-based testing, test estimation, test metrics, defect management, test reporting, configuration management, and exit criteria. These topics help ensure that testing efforts remain organized, measurable, and aligned with project objectives while delivering maximum business value.

What this chapter covers
Chapter 5, 'Managing the Test Activities', is 9 of 40 questions. Risk is the spine of the chapter — risk analysis drives what gets tested, how much, and in what order, and risk questions appear throughout the exam rather than only here.
Test planning defines objectives, scope, approach, and resources. The test plan documents entry criteria (what must be in place before testing starts) and exit criteria (what must be true before it stops). The syllabus is clear that criteria unmet does not automatically mean testing continues — a stakeholder may accept the risk and proceed. Testers contribute to iteration and release planning by estimating effort, identifying risks, and prioritising user stories.
Estimation techniques include estimation based on ratios, extrapolation, the Wideband Delphi expert-based approach, and three-point estimation, where the estimate is derived from optimistic, most likely, and pessimistic values. Test case prioritisation may be risk-based, coverage-based, or requirements-based. The test pyramid describes the desirable shape of an automated suite — many fast unit tests, fewer service tests, fewest slow UI tests — while the testing quadrants classify tests by whether they support the team or critique the product, and whether they are business- or technology-facing.
Risk is the combination of the likelihood of an event and its impact. Project risks threaten the project's capability to deliver (staffing, supplier, organisational); product risks threaten the quality of the product itself (a defect causing failure in use). Product risk analysis comprises risk identification and risk assessment, and produces the basis for risk control: mitigation, contingency, transfer, or acceptance. Risk level determines the depth and order of testing.
Test monitoring gathers information about progress; test control acts on it, adjusting course to meet objectives. Metrics may cover progress against plan, defect counts and trends, coverage achieved, and confidence. Test reports communicate status — a test progress report during execution, a test completion report at the end of an activity or level. The audience determines the content: a technical team and an executive sponsor need different reports from the same data.
Configuration management ensures every item of testware is uniquely identified, version-controlled, and traceable, so tests can be reproduced against a known version of the test object. Defect management defines the workflow a reported anomaly follows, and the syllabus specifies the content of a defect report: identifier, title and summary, date and author, identification of the test object and environment, steps to reproduce, expected and actual results, severity, priority, status, and references.

Common exam traps
- Mixing up severity and priority. Severity is the impact of the failure; priority is the urgency of fixing it.
- Confusing project risk with product risk — the exam supplies scenarios that sit close to the line.
- Assuming exit criteria not met always blocks release. Risk can be formally accepted instead.
- Reading monitoring and control as one activity. Monitoring observes; control intervenes.
